Forsyth Jones (OP)
|
|
September 19, 2018, 01:15:43 AM Last edit: September 22, 2018, 01:18:46 AM by #BitcoinCore |
|
De acordo com o post do Theymos foi descoberto um bug pelos devs do core, que segundo nas palavras dele, permite que qualquer um com força computacional ao minerar um bloco via POW pode crashar a sua cópia da blockchain, pelo menos foi o que entendi, e o mais importante: Seus fundos estão seguros, não se preocupem, não precisam se desesperar, mais detalhes em: Post do Theymos > https://bitcointalk.org/index.php?topic=5032443.0 Post do lançamento da nova versão do Core: https://bitcointalk.org/index.php?topic=5032424.0 Post em português explicando melhor o bug: https://portaldobitcoin.com/erro-muito-assustador-comprometido-bitcoin/Don't worry fundis ar 'saifu'
|
| | . .Duelbits. | │ | ..........UNLEASH.......... THE ULTIMATE GAMING EXPERIENCE | │ | DUELBITS FANTASY SPORTS | ████▄▄▄█████▄▄▄ ░▄████████████████▄ ▐██████████████████▄ ████████████████████ ████████████████████▌ █████████████████████ ████████████████▀▀▀ ███████████████▌ ███████████████▌ ████████████████ ████████████████ ████████████████ ████▀▀███████▀▀ | . ▬▬ VS ▬▬ | ████▄▄▄█████▄▄▄ ░▄████████████████▄ ▐██████████████████▄ ████████████████████ ████████████████████▌ █████████████████████ ███████████████████ ███████████████▌ ███████████████▌ ████████████████ ████████████████ ████████████████ ████▀▀███████▀▀ | /// PLAY FOR FREE /// WIN FOR REAL | │ | ..PLAY NOW.. | |
|
|
|
alegotardo
Legendary
Offline
Activity: 2604
Merit: 1229
☢️ alegotardo™️
|
|
September 19, 2018, 10:53:10 AM |
|
De acordo com o post do Theymos foi descoberto um bug pelos devs do core, que segundo nas palavras dele, permite que qualquer um com força computacional ao minerar um bloco via POW pode crashar a sua cópia da blockchain, pelo menos foi o que entendi, e o mais importante: Seus fundos estão seguros, não se preocupem, não precisam se desesperar, mais detalhes em: Post do Theymos > https://bitcointalk.org/index.php?topic=5032443.0 Post do lançamento da nova versão do Core: https://bitcointalk.org/index.php?topic=5032424.0Don't worry fundis ar 'saifu' Um crash na blockchain do BTC seria algo terrivelmente terrível... Imagina você ter que baixar novamente os 180Gb de dados Por "menor" que seja os bugs, bacana ver que os devs são sempre rápidos para agir em cima das correções.
|
| . .Duelbits. | │ | | │ | ▄▄█▄▄░░▄▄█▄▄░░▄▄█▄▄ ███░░░░███░░░░███ ▀░░░▀░░▀░░░▀░░▀░░░▀ ▄░░░░░░░░░░░░ ▀██████████ ░░░░░███░░░░▀ ░░█░░░███▄█░░░█ ░░██▌░░███░▀░░██▌ ░█░██░░███░░░█░██ ░█▀▀▀█▌░███░░█▀▀▀█▌ ▄█▄░░░██▄███▄█▄░░▄██▄ ▄███▄ ░░░░▀██▄▀ | . REGIONAL SPONSOR | | ███▀██▀███▀█▀▀▀▀██▀▀▀██ ██░▀░██░█░███░▀██░███▄█ █▄███▄██▄████▄████▄▄▄██ ██▀ ▀███▀▀░▀██▀▀▀██████ ███▄███░▄▀██████▀█▀█▀▀█ ████▀▀██▄▀█████▄█▀███▄█ ███▄▄▄████████▄█▄▀█████ ███▀▀▀████████████▄▀███ ███▄░▄█▀▀▀██████▀▀▀▄███ ███████▄██▄▌████▀▀█████ ▀██▄███▀██▄█▄▄▄██▄████▀ ▀▀██████████▄▄███▀▀ ▀▀▀▀█▀▀▀▀ | . EUROPEAN BETTING PARTNER | |
|
|
|
girino
Legendary
Offline
Activity: 2296
Merit: 1170
Advertise Here - PM for more info!
|
|
September 19, 2018, 01:09:43 PM |
|
De acordo com o post do Theymos foi descoberto um bug pelos devs do core, que segundo nas palavras dele, permite que qualquer um com força computacional ao minerar um bloco via POW pode crashar a sua cópia da blockchain, pelo menos foi o que entendi, e o mais importante: Seus fundos estão seguros, não se preocupem, não precisam se desesperar, mais detalhes em: Post do Theymos > https://bitcointalk.org/index.php?topic=5032443.0 Post do lançamento da nova versão do Core: https://bitcointalk.org/index.php?topic=5032424.0Don't worry fundis ar 'saifu' Um crash na blockchain do BTC seria algo terrivelmente terrível... Imagina você ter que baixar novamente os 180Gb de dados Por "menor" que seja os bugs, bacana ver que os devs são sempre rápidos para agir em cima das correções. O custo desse ataque é muito alto, e o impacto muito baixo, por isso ninguem fez. (o ataque crasharia todos os nodes ligados ao minerador, e não se propagaria alem disso, então o minerador precisaria tentar se conectar ao maximo possivel de nodes da rede pra conseguir algum sucesso, tudo isso perdendo a recompensa pelos blocos minerados).
|
Advertise Here - PM for more info!
|
|
|
arthurbonora
|
|
September 19, 2018, 02:39:41 PM |
|
quem roda o core hoje, me tira uma dúvida, precisa de quantos gigas pra rodar?
|
|
|
|
Silenox
|
|
September 19, 2018, 04:42:20 PM |
|
quem roda o core hoje, me tira uma dúvida, precisa de quantos gigas pra rodar?
Se você se refere ao tamanho do Blockchain pelo que sei está em torno de 180GB, é bem complicado rodar o Core e/ou manter um node sem uma conexão excelente, se não fosse tão difícil eu queria manter um, mas atualmente não tenho condições.
|
|
|
|
arthurbonora
|
|
September 19, 2018, 04:46:26 PM |
|
quem roda o core hoje, me tira uma dúvida, precisa de quantos gigas pra rodar?
Se você se refere ao tamanho do Blockchain pelo que sei está em torno de 180GB, é bem complicado rodar o Core e/ou manter um node sem uma conexão excelente, se não fosse tão difícil eu queria manter um, mas atualmente não tenho condições. Essa era minha dúvida mesmo, 180gb é realmente muita coisa, acho que poderiam criar um jeito de otimizar, sei lá.
|
|
|
|
TryNinja
Legendary
Offline
Activity: 3024
Merit: 7443
Top Crypto Casino
|
Essa era minha dúvida mesmo, 180gb é realmente muita coisa, acho que poderiam criar um jeito de otimizar, sei lá.
Você pode rodar o Core em modo "prune", o que deleta a grande maioria dos blocos anteriores e deixa apenas os mais recentes. Adicionando prune=550 no seu arquivo bitcoin.conf, o Core utiliza apenas cerca de 2gb e 3gb de espaço.
Você pode saber mais sobre essa função aqui: https://coinguides.org/bitcoin-blockchain-pruning/
|
|
|
|
arthurbonora
|
|
September 19, 2018, 05:04:51 PM |
|
Essa era minha dúvida mesmo, 180gb é realmente muita coisa, acho que poderiam criar um jeito de otimizar, sei lá.
Você pode rodar o Core em modo "prune", o que deleta a grande maioria dos blocos anteriores e deixa apenas os mais recentes. Adicionando prune=550 no seu arquivo bitcoin.conf, o Core utiliza apenas cerca de 2gb e 3gb de espaço.
Você pode saber mais sobre essa função aqui: https://coinguides.org/bitcoin-blockchain-pruning/Ai ja ta melhorando eim, kkk valew, vou testar esse modo pra dai rodar o core
|
|
|
|
bitmover
Legendary
Offline
Activity: 2492
Merit: 6321
bitcoindata.science
|
|
September 19, 2018, 08:10:34 PM |
|
|
|
|
|
Silenox
|
|
September 19, 2018, 08:38:44 PM |
|
Essa era minha dúvida mesmo, 180gb é realmente muita coisa, acho que poderiam criar um jeito de otimizar, sei lá.
Você pode rodar o Core em modo "prune", o que deleta a grande maioria dos blocos anteriores e deixa apenas os mais recentes. Adicionando prune=550 no seu arquivo bitcoin.conf, o Core utiliza apenas cerca de 2gb e 3gb de espaço.
Você pode saber mais sobre essa função aqui: https://coinguides.org/bitcoin-blockchain-pruning/Nem citei essa possibilidade, mas ela existe mesmo, como nunca rodei o Core não sei como funciona, se tem algum tipo de limitação ou é só o registro mais recente do blockchain, mas acho que essa opção é só pra rodar a carteira do Core, e não um full node, mas posso estar enganado.
|
|
|
|
wilwxk
|
|
September 19, 2018, 11:43:43 PM |
|
Essa era minha dúvida mesmo, 180gb é realmente muita coisa, acho que poderiam criar um jeito de otimizar, sei lá.
Você pode rodar o Core em modo "prune", o que deleta a grande maioria dos blocos anteriores e deixa apenas os mais recentes. Adicionando prune=550 no seu arquivo bitcoin.conf, o Core utiliza apenas cerca de 2gb e 3gb de espaço.
Você pode saber mais sobre essa função aqui: https://coinguides.org/bitcoin-blockchain-pruning/Nem citei essa possibilidade, mas ela existe mesmo, como nunca rodei o Core não sei como funciona, se tem algum tipo de limitação ou é só o registro mais recente do blockchain, mas acho que essa opção é só pra rodar a carteira do Core, e não um full node, mas posso estar enganado. Se você está com o modo prune ativado e a função de mempool também, então você já está ajudando a rede retransmitindo essas transações, mas é sempre melhor e mais seguro você manter uma cópia inteira da blockchain. Sobre o prune o que muitos não sabem é que você ainda precisa fazer o download da blockchain inteira para só depois começar a fazer a "poda" nos seus arquivos, isso porque ainda é preciso que você tenha a cadeia completa para fazer a verificação da cadeia que você está seguindo (se você tiver uma cadeia adulterada, é possível que você continue recebendo os blocos dela em vez da real), depois da verificação os blocos mais antigos podem ser descartados para otimizar o espaço. Então de qualquer jeito você vai precisar dos 180gb.
|
|
|
|
sabotag3x
Legendary
Offline
Activity: 2716
Merit: 2338
|
|
September 19, 2018, 11:56:23 PM |
|
Se você está com o modo prune ativado e a função de mempool também, então você já está ajudando a rede retransmitindo essas transações, mas é sempre melhor e mais seguro você manter uma cópia inteira da blockchain.
Sobre o prune o que muitos não sabem é que você ainda precisa fazer o download da blockchain inteira para só depois começar a fazer a "poda" nos seus arquivos, isso porque ainda é preciso que você tenha a cadeia completa para fazer a verificação da cadeia que você está seguindo (se você tiver uma cadeia adulterada, é possível que você continue recebendo os blocos dela em vez da real), depois da verificação os blocos mais antigos podem ser descartados para otimizar o espaço. Então de qualquer jeito você vai precisar dos 180gb.
Quais blocos são excluídos nessa poda? todos os mais antigos? ou apenas blocos órfãos, etc?
|
|
|
|
TryNinja
Legendary
Offline
Activity: 3024
Merit: 7443
Top Crypto Casino
|
|
September 19, 2018, 11:59:34 PM |
|
Quais blocos são excluídos nessa poda? todos os mais antigos? ou apenas blocos órfãos, etc?
Os mais antigos. A configuração é prune=N em que N é igual ao tamanho máximo (em MiB) que você quer guardar de blocos. Por exemplo, prune=5000 excluiria todos os blocos (dos mais antigos para os mais novos) até ter um máximo de 5gb em blocos (você sempre vai ter só o equivalente a 5gb de blocos). E sim, o que o @wilwxk é verdade. Mesmo assim você ainda tem que baixar a blockchain por inteiro antes de começar a "prunar". Se você souber inglês, leia o post que eu linkei acima.
|
|
|
|
DeltaX_Slayer
|
|
September 20, 2018, 04:17:46 AM |
|
Muita gente deve ter o backup salvo em algum lugar. Se alguém fosse fazer esse ataque, que ao que parece não renderia fruto nenhum, seria apenas por diversão.
|
|
|
|
girino
Legendary
Offline
Activity: 2296
Merit: 1170
Advertise Here - PM for more info!
|
|
September 20, 2018, 12:56:10 PM |
|
Muita gente deve ter o backup salvo em algum lugar. Se alguém fosse fazer esse ataque, que ao que parece não renderia fruto nenhum, seria apenas por diversão.
E efeito de um ataque desse seria tirar a rede do ar por umas poucas horas (um patch ou "workaround" seria disponibilizado em pouco tempo, e o povo ficaria fora do ar até atualizar ou aplicar o patch). Pode parecer bobagem, mas faria o preço despencar.
|
Advertise Here - PM for more info!
|
|
|
tublo
Member
Offline
Activity: 103
Merit: 31
|
|
September 20, 2018, 07:10:59 PM |
|
Essa era minha dúvida mesmo, 180gb é realmente muita coisa, acho que poderiam criar um jeito de otimizar, sei lá.
Você pode rodar o Core em modo "prune", o que deleta a grande maioria dos blocos anteriores e deixa apenas os mais recentes. Adicionando prune=550 no seu arquivo bitcoin.conf, o Core utiliza apenas cerca de 2gb e 3gb de espaço.
Você pode saber mais sobre essa função aqui: https://coinguides.org/bitcoin-blockchain-pruning/Nem citei essa possibilidade, mas ela existe mesmo, como nunca rodei o Core não sei como funciona, se tem algum tipo de limitação ou é só o registro mais recente do blockchain, mas acho que essa opção é só pra rodar a carteira do Core, e não um full node, mas posso estar enganado. Se você está com o modo prune ativado e a função de mempool também, então você já está ajudando a rede retransmitindo essas transações, mas é sempre melhor e mais seguro você manter uma cópia inteira da blockchain. Sobre o prune o que muitos não sabem é que você ainda precisa fazer o download da blockchain inteira para só depois começar a fazer a "poda" nos seus arquivos, isso porque ainda é preciso que você tenha a cadeia completa para fazer a verificação da cadeia que você está seguindo (se você tiver uma cadeia adulterada, é possível que você continue recebendo os blocos dela em vez da real), depois da verificação os blocos mais antigos podem ser descartados para otimizar o espaço. Então de qualquer jeito você vai precisar dos 180gb. Não é mais seguro manter a blockchain inteira. A segurança de um nó pruned é a mesma, pois todas as transações foram validadas localmente. Também não é preciso ter o espaço de 180 GB para usar o prune. O software vai descartando os dados à medida em que baixa novos.
|
|
|
|
girino
Legendary
Offline
Activity: 2296
Merit: 1170
Advertise Here - PM for more info!
|
|
September 20, 2018, 07:24:12 PM |
|
Essa era minha dúvida mesmo, 180gb é realmente muita coisa, acho que poderiam criar um jeito de otimizar, sei lá.
Você pode rodar o Core em modo "prune", o que deleta a grande maioria dos blocos anteriores e deixa apenas os mais recentes. Adicionando prune=550 no seu arquivo bitcoin.conf, o Core utiliza apenas cerca de 2gb e 3gb de espaço.
Você pode saber mais sobre essa função aqui: https://coinguides.org/bitcoin-blockchain-pruning/Nem citei essa possibilidade, mas ela existe mesmo, como nunca rodei o Core não sei como funciona, se tem algum tipo de limitação ou é só o registro mais recente do blockchain, mas acho que essa opção é só pra rodar a carteira do Core, e não um full node, mas posso estar enganado. Se você está com o modo prune ativado e a função de mempool também, então você já está ajudando a rede retransmitindo essas transações, mas é sempre melhor e mais seguro você manter uma cópia inteira da blockchain. Sobre o prune o que muitos não sabem é que você ainda precisa fazer o download da blockchain inteira para só depois começar a fazer a "poda" nos seus arquivos, isso porque ainda é preciso que você tenha a cadeia completa para fazer a verificação da cadeia que você está seguindo (se você tiver uma cadeia adulterada, é possível que você continue recebendo os blocos dela em vez da real), depois da verificação os blocos mais antigos podem ser descartados para otimizar o espaço. Então de qualquer jeito você vai precisar dos 180gb. Não é mais seguro manter a blockchain inteira. A segurança de um nó pruned é a mesma, pois todas as transações foram validadas localmente. Também não é preciso ter o espaço de 180 GB para usar o prune. O software vai descartando os dados à medida em que baixa novos. a desvantagem é que ele ainda assim tem de fazer o download dos 180GB. Só economiza espaço em disco, não economiza banda.
|
Advertise Here - PM for more info!
|
|
|
Forsyth Jones (OP)
|
|
September 21, 2018, 12:34:24 AM |
|
A desvantagem de prunnar um node é que você não vai mais poder escanear a wallet, exemplo, se você restaurar uma nova carteira e a wallet não vai enxergar os saldos mesmo contendo saldo e não será possível dar rescan na blockchain, não tem como você importar uma chave privada também, e se importar um endereço de assistir, ele só vai enxergar as transações a partir dos blocos que você já tem, não recomendo prunning, não custa baixar toda a blockchain e usufluir todos os recursos do core...
Porque baixar um node completo: você de todo jeito vai ter que baixar a blockchain, mesmo feito o prunning, então porque já não deixar como full node já que vai baixar a blockchain?
cabe no seu HD, se não couber, um HD externo é barato, comprei o meu por menos de R$ 200 de 1tb
Simplesmente não tem desculpas, sendo que você vai estar usufluindo todos os recursos da moeda.
|
| | . .Duelbits. | │ | ..........UNLEASH.......... THE ULTIMATE GAMING EXPERIENCE | │ | DUELBITS FANTASY SPORTS | ████▄▄▄█████▄▄▄ ░▄████████████████▄ ▐██████████████████▄ ████████████████████ ████████████████████▌ █████████████████████ ████████████████▀▀▀ ███████████████▌ ███████████████▌ ████████████████ ████████████████ ████████████████ ████▀▀███████▀▀ | . ▬▬ VS ▬▬ | ████▄▄▄█████▄▄▄ ░▄████████████████▄ ▐██████████████████▄ ████████████████████ ████████████████████▌ █████████████████████ ███████████████████ ███████████████▌ ███████████████▌ ████████████████ ████████████████ ████████████████ ████▀▀███████▀▀ | /// PLAY FOR FREE /// WIN FOR REAL | │ | ..PLAY NOW.. | |
|
|
|
Silenox
|
|
September 21, 2018, 12:57:13 AM |
|
A desvantagem de prunnar um node é que você não vai mais poder escanear a wallet, exemplo, se você restaurar uma nova carteira e a wallet não vai enxergar os saldos mesmo contendo saldo e não será possível dar rescan na blockchain, não tem como você importar uma chave privada também, e se importar um endereço de assistir, ele só vai enxergar as transações a partir dos blocos que você já tem, não recomendo prunning, não custa baixar toda a blockchain e usufluir todos os recursos do core...
Porque baixar um node completo: você de todo jeito vai ter que baixar a blockchain, mesmo feito o prunning, então porque já não deixar como full node já que vai baixar a blockchain?
cabe no seu HD, se não couber, um HD externo é barato, comprei o meu por menos de R$ 200 de 1tb
Simplesmente não tem desculpas, sendo que você vai estar usufluindo todos os recursos da moeda.
Se for olhar por esse lado realmente não vale muito a pena usar a versão "prunada", o ideal é mesmo manter a blockchain inteira, fazendo um backup regularmente para não ter que baoxar tudo de novo se der algum problema.
|
|
|
|
|
|